Where did it occur?

Monte Cassino, Italy Fought by the Allies with the

intention of breaking through the Winter Line and seizing Rome.

What was at stake? The city of Rome and the city of

Cassino. In the beginning the Germans were

holding the Rapido, Liri, and Garigliano valleys and surrounding peaks. But they didn’t have the historic abbey of Monte Cassino. On February 15, the abbey was destroyed by American bombers and after German poured into the ruins to defend it. From January 17- May 18 the abbey was assaulted 4 more times by allied troops for a loss of 54,000 allied and 20,000 German soldiers.
